For this week's sync, note that the Pellworth relevance experiments write their scoring snapshots to the secondary analytics store, not the primary index. Each tuning run records boost weights, synonym map versions, and click-model deltas so we can replay rankings deterministically. Please avoid truncating the snapshot tables mid-experiment; the Fenlow dashboard joins against them hourly. If you need to inspect raw scoring rows yourself, query the analytics store directly using the connection string provided below.

primary connection of tajeg-tajop = postgresql://julax_svc:DI@db-e7f3.kelvidyn.corp:5432/rusdor

## Ownership: Export Memory

The Gridwell spreadsheet exporter buffers entire workbooks in heap before streaming. Anything over ~40k rows spikes memory past 2GB and gets the pod killed. Known issue, tracked since the Larkspur release. Mitigation: chunked writes landed behind a flag, not yet default. Do not raise pod limits as a workaround; it masks the regression. Questions, flag changes, or limit tweaks go through one owner. For this area, escalate directly to the engineer named below.

account owner for fajep-yagef: Kasix Eliiel

Hey Priya — quick handover on Widediff, our large-file diff viewer. Plugin authors hook into the chunk pipeline; anything over the size ceiling gets streamed, so plugins must handle partial hunks. Ravi's syntax plugin is the reference example if folks ask. Memory limits are strict on the shared tier — remind authors not to buffer whole files. The defaults plugins inherit are in the config below.

config for kajef-hahof:
[ulamir]
port = 5672
region = central-1
host = ulamir.lumicsys.corp
timeout_ms = 2000
retries = 3

## Environment variables — Pingfold deduplicator

Pingfold collapses duplicate on-call alerts within a configurable window (DEDUP_WINDOW_SECONDS, default 300). Set ALERT_SOURCE_MODE to "strict" unless a customer explicitly asks otherwise. Both live in dedup.env alongside the upstream pager credential, which must be present or the service exits on startup. Add that credential as the next line:

env line for bafof-bawig: RELAY_SECRET3=325